Ulrich, Hunnam and Goode In Consideration For The Crow Reboot

The Crow reboot is now starting to put together possible actors to play the lead.

It was recently revealed by Ryan Kavanaugh, the producer of the upcoming reboot of "The Crow" series, that all the pieces were now coming together for the film. Now comes word from a couple of sources that they have gone as far as having a list of possible actors to play Eric Draven a.k.a. The Crow. Brandon Lee played Draven in the original film and died on the set of the film.

Three of the actors on the list are reported to be Skeet Ulrich (Armored), Charlie Hunnam (Sons of Anarchy), and Matthew Goode (Watchmen). However, it is yet to be confirmed.

"The Crow" reboot will be directed by Stephen Norrington and is expected to be released between 2011 and 2013. Stay tuned for news.
